Restraint Factor for the Airline Industry Market
Fuel price fluctuation severely limits expansion in the airline sector market. Fuel expenditures make up a significant amount of an airline's operating expenses. Therefore, fluctuations in crude oil prices are a major worry. Sudden increases in fuel prices can erode business margins, causing airlines to boost ticket rates, which may reduce demand. Unpredictable declines in fuel prices, on the other hand, present budgeting and financial planning issues. Furthermore, hedging options for managing fuel price risks can be costly and difficult. This unpredictability complicates long-term strategy planning, fleet upgrade investments, and other capital expenditures. As a result, airlines must constantly react to fluctuating fuel costs, compromising their capacity to maintain stable and competitive operations and limiting total market growth and profitability.

Demand for Faster, More Reliable Connectivity Is Growing: As connected devices proliferate and aviation relies more and more on real-time data, there is a growing need for faster, more dependable connectivity. Compared to earlier generations, 5G offers much faster data rates and reduced latency, which appeals to a range of aviation applications.
Improved Passenger Experience: Airlines are always looking for methods to make the traveller experience better. 5G can improve customer pleasure and loyalty by enabling smooth in-flight entertainment streaming, high-quality video conferencing, and speedier internet surfing.
Operational Efficiency: By utilising 5G, airports and airlines may enhance their operational efficiency. For example, reduced latency and faster data transmission can improve aircraft maintenance procedures, allow for real-time equipment monitoring, and speed up flight turnaround times.
Predictive maintenance and remote monitoring of aircraft systems and components are made possible by 5G technology. This can improve fleet reliability overall, cut maintenance costs, and minimise downtime for airlines.
Advanced Navigation and Communication: Air traffic control (ATC) and aircraft-to-aircraft communication can be supported by 5G networks through advanced navigation and communication technologies. This can promote more effective routing, increase safety, and improve airspace management—especially in crowded airspace.
new Technologies: The capabilities of 5G networks can be advantageous for the integration of new technologies such as un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) and autonomous drones in aviation. Real-time data transfer and low-latency communication—two essential 5G features—are largely relied upon by these technologies.

Growing Air Traffic: There is a global rise in air traffic as a result of the rising demand for air travel. In order to control airspace congestion and optimise aircraft routes, this has increased the demand for more sophisticated and effective flight management systems.
Modernization of Aircraft Fleet: Pilots and airlines frequently replace their older, less technologically sophisticated aircraft with newer models. This includes adding cutting-edge Flight Management Systems and other sophisticated avionics to already-existing aeroplanes.
Fuel Economy and Cost Savings: Airlines are always looking for methods to cut expenses and increase fuel economy. Airlines find advanced flight management systems (FMS) to be a desirable investment since they can optimise flight trajectories, speeds, and other factors, resulting in fuel savings.
Regulations: Modifications to aviation laws and rules may encourage the use of Flight Management Systems and other cutting-edge avionics. Airlines may need to update or modify their current systems in order to comply with new requirements.
Technological developments: The need for more recent FMS solutions may be fueled by developments in technology, which include the ability to integrate FMS with other avionics systems, better navigational capabilities, and increased automation features.
Emphasis on Safety and Accurate Navigation: Flight Management Systems are essential for guaranteeing both flight safety and precise navigation. The aviation sector prioritises safety, so new developments in FMS technology that improve navigation accuracy and safety in general are probably going to be in high demand.
Growing Emerging Markets: The need for new aircraft and cutting-edge avionics equipment is influenced by the growth of air transport in emerging markets. To improve their operating capabilities, airlines in these locations might spend money on new FMS.
Growing Demand for Next-Gen Aircraft: Next-generation aircraft, like the Airbus A320neo and Boeing 737 MAX, are becoming more and more popular. They frequently have sophisticated Flight Management Systems and other cutting-edge electronics.
Growing Attention to Airspace Management: In order to optimise routes, effectively manage air traffic, and adhere to changing airspace laws, improved FMS is required as airspace management becomes more complex.

The pandemic decimated the International Airlines industry, but the industry rebounded rapidly over the two years through 2022-23 after international and state borders reopened. Notwithstanding airfreight transport, the industry's services were essentially non-existent while international borders were shut. Weakening global economic conditions and a cost-of-living crisis domestically disrupted the industry’s recovery in 2023-24. Overall, the industry has seen mild growth off a low base year in 2019-20, with revenue set to climb by an annualised 1.1% over the five years through 2024-25, to reach $33.8 billion. Industry revenue growth is expected to be weak in the current year, at 0.4%, as high interest rates and weak consumer sentiment limit growth in domestic travel while recession fears overseas limit growth in international arrivals. Like revenue, the pandemic also caused a sharp decline in average profit margins, with international airlines making significant losses while heavy restrictions on international air travel were in place. International airlines incur high fixed costs, which surged as a share of revenue amid dismal demand conditions. Margins have recovered over the three years through 2024-25 as international borders have reopened, and are expected to have returned to pre-pandemic levels. Revenue for the International Airlines industry is set to rise at an annualised 2.5% through the end of 2029-30 to reach $38.3 billion. International travel has strong underlying demand and has traditionally recovered quickly after periods of shock-driven decline. Nonetheless, persistent weakness in global and domestic consumer sentiment and economic conditions is forecast to limit growth. A steady recovery in demand is projected to see fixed depreciation costs and labour costs drop as a share of revenue over the next five years, supporting a rise in industry margins.
